Abstract

A 13-month-old girl presented with developmental delay, generalized hypotonia, vertical pendular nystagmus, and cranial nerves IV, V, and VII paresis. MRI (figure) revealed pontine hypoplasia with ectopic dorsal transverse pontine fibers (tegmental cap). Concomitant profound sensorineural deafness and a butterfly Th2 vertebra led to the syndromic diagnosis …
